[0031] Figure 4A fault diagnosis device for an electric drive of an embodiment of the present invention is shown. The electric drive of the present invention includes a power source 28 , a frequency converter 29 and a load 30 . The load 30 can be, for example, an electric motor 30 . The frequency converter 29 includes a rectifier unit 31 , a direct voltage intermediate circuit 32 and an inverter unit 33 . The rectifier unit 31 of the frequency converter 29 of the electric drive of the invention converts the AC voltage from the power supply 28 into a DC voltage. For example, the frequency converter 29 can be rectified by means of a 6-pulse diode bridge. The direct voltage obtained from the rectifier unit 31 of the frequency converter 29 is stored in a direct voltage intermediate circuit 32 as an energy store.
